Help with player icons on the field

Ok, Im going to try and explain this as best I can. I dont play with the 3d mode, I use the next step down so things have the new loo but none of the little guys running around. However EVERY game I play in a new stadium, I have to move all the player icons around so that they fit in the right spots on the field and its the most annoying thing Ive ever come across.

Is there a way to do these locations and set them for every park?

Ive tried going into the teams stadium and seeing if there is anything I can do in there but nothing allows the view i use so I have no idea what to do. Any help would be appreciated.

This is a fictional league if that means anything

League Settings / Edit Ballparks. Click on the "Actions" drop-down and there should be an option for "Assign day-time picture coordinates & ball locations to all parks". Hopefully this is what you are looking for...

I don't think there is a way to set positions league-wide. You probably have to set positions separately for each park. You can use a copy and paste option after placing players in the day version and put those placements into the night version of the park (or vice versa).
